    <title>Question Re: How to show the project on dashboard for the resource who did nothing in Product Lifecycle Management Q&amp;A</title>
    <link>https://community.sap.com/t5/product-lifecycle-management-q-a/how-to-show-the-project-on-dashboard-for-the-resource-who-did-nothing/qaa-p/7225236#M34973</link>
    <description>&lt;HTML&gt;&lt;HEAD&gt;&lt;/HEAD&gt;&lt;BODY&gt;&lt;P&gt;Hi, &l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;The user should have atleast "Read" authorization for the project, so that the  details for the project are visible on the dashboard. It is not necessary that the user should be "responsible resource". &l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;In case the user is assigned only as a resource, atleast the "read" authorization should be provided for the project via ACL manuallly. Or else use "Default authorization for Project role type" in Project role customizing, so that the user gets authorization automatically on staffing a resource. &l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Regarding populating the list of projects on Dashboard, you can make use of "Favourites". Need to add the current staffed projects for a resource as favourites through a custom development. &l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Regards &l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Sejo&lt;/P&gt;&lt;/BODY&gt;&lt;/HTML&gt;</description>
